Over the last three months, the temperatures assessed across all latitude bands were warmer than the 1951-1980 average, except around the Southern Ocean/Antarctic.

[Plot shows zonal-mean surface temperature anomalies, with latitude = y-axis (not scaled by distance). GISTEMPv4.]
